Output 2586551060bf2a6c3c09d669ba7ac2c2cf3dedfd8d4d2156e24c7aeb39b4bb8a:1

value
46149030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93adcc5f31be87dcb343d37f6e4397920a7420b8 OP_EQUAL
address
3F9sTTmWrwFifsvD8YgNbHfK9tnNdyK4Sd
transaction
2586551060bf2a6c3c09d669ba7ac2c2cf3dedfd8d4d2156e24c7aeb39b4bb8a
spent
true